Rear shifter, right hand, clamp-band, 12-speed — that's the SL-M8100-R in a sentence, and it's what most riders actually want when they say they need "an XT shifter." Shimano's Deore XT 12-speed group has been the workhorse trail spec for years now, and the shifter is where you feel the group's personality most directly under your thumb. This is the standalone right-side trigger, so you're pairing it with any 12-speed Shimano mountain rear derailleur (RD-M8100, RD-M7100, or RD-M6100) and running a Micro Spline cassette out back.
The SL-M8100 borrows its shift architecture from XTR M9100, so you get the same feature set — Instant Release, Multi Release, and 2-Way Release — with a slightly larger thumb paddle and a rubberized textured pad that keeps your glove planted when things get wet. Shimano's own numbers put the shift force 35% lower than the outgoing M8000 generation and lever access roughly 20% quicker, which lines up with what riders report after swapping from 11-speed XT. Multi Release lets you drop up to four gears in a single sweep of the thumb paddle, useful when a climb pitches up faster than you saw coming. The second click has a deliberately firmer detent so you don't blow past your intended gear under load.
This is the clamp-band version, so it uses the standard 22.2mm bar mount rather than I-SPEC EV. If you're running non-Shimano brakes — SRAM, Hayes, TRP, Magura — this is the version you want, since I-SPEC EV only mates to matching Shimano brake levers. The tradeoff is a second clamp on the bar instead of an integrated cockpit, but the upside is bar-position flexibility and universal brake compatibility. Housing terminates at the shifter with a barrel adjuster for on-the-fly cable tension tweaks, and Shimano includes an OptiSlick-coated inner cable in the box.
Features
- Right-hand rear shifter for 12-speed Shimano mountain drivetrains
- Compatible with RD-M8100, RD-M7100, and RD-M6100 rear derailleurs
- Requires Micro Spline freehub cassette (CS-M8100, CS-M7100, or CS-M6100)
- RapidFire Plus trigger mechanism with Instant Release, Multi Release, and 2-Way Release
- Up to 4-gear downshift in a single lever throw
- Rubberized textured pad on main thumb lever
- 22.2mm clamp-band mount (works with any brake system)
- Not compatible with I-SPEC EV or I-SPEC II brake levers in this version
- OT-SP41 housing recommended
- OptiSlick-coated stainless inner cable included (2050mm)
- Aluminum, glass-fiber-reinforced polymer, and steel construction
- 117 grams
